Prep Time: 10 mins
Cook Time: 20 mins
Total Time: 30 mins
Cuisine: Italian
Serves: 2 pizzas

Ingredients

  1. 2 cups all-purpose flour
  2. 1 cup beer
  3. 1 tbsp olive oil
  4. 2 tsp garlic powder
  5. 1 tsp dried oregano
  6. 1 tsp dried basil
  7. 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
  8. 1/2 cup pizza sauce
  9. Salt to taste

Instructions

  1. In a large mixing bowl, combine the all-purpose flour, garlic powder, dried oregano, dried basil, and salt. Mix the dry ingredients thoroughly to ensure even distribution of herbs and spices.
  2. Create a well in the center of the dry ingredients and pour in the beer and olive oil. Gradually mix the wet and dry ingredients using a wooden spoon or your hands until a soft, slightly sticky dough forms.
  3. Knead the dough on a lightly floured surface for about 5-7 minutes until it becomes smooth and elastic. If the dough feels too sticky, add a small amount of flour; if too dry, add a little more beer.
  4. Place the dough in a lightly oiled bowl, cover with a clean kitchen towel, and let it rest for 10 minutes at room temperature. This allows the gluten to relax and makes the dough easier to stretch.
  5. Preheat your oven to 450°F (230°C). If you have a pizza stone, place it in the oven during preheating to ensure a crispy crust.
  6. Divide the dough into two equal portions. On a floured surface, use your hands or a rolling pin to stretch each portion into a thin, round pizza base, about 12 inches in diameter.
  7. Transfer the pizza bases to a baking sheet lined with parchment paper or a preheated pizza stone.
  8. Spread 1/4 cup of pizza sauce evenly over each pizza base, leaving a small border around the edges for the crust.
  9. Sprinkle 1/2 cup of shredded mozzarella cheese over each pizza, ensuring even coverage.
  10. Bake the pizzas in the preheated oven for 15-20 minutes, or until the crust is golden brown and the cheese is melted and slightly bubbling.
  11. Remove the pizzas from the oven and let them cool for 2-3 minutes. This allows the cheese to set and makes slicing easier.
  12. Optional: Drizzle with a little extra olive oil, sprinkle with additional dried herbs, or add fresh basil leaves before serving.
  13. Slice each pizza into 8 wedges and serve hot. Enjoy your homemade beer pizza with garlic and herbs!

Tips

  1. Beer Selection Matters: Choose a lighter beer like a pale ale or lager for the best dough texture. Avoid heavy stouts or dark beers that might make the dough too dense.
  2. Dough Consistency is Key: Don't overwork the dough. The magic happens when you mix just until ingredients are combined, which keeps the crust light and crispy.
  3. Preheating is Crucial: Ensure your oven (and pizza stone, if using) is fully preheated to 450°F for that perfect crisp crust with beautiful golden edges.
  4. Herb Pro Tip: For an extra flavor boost, toast your dried herbs briefly in a dry pan before adding them to the dough to enhance their aromatic qualities.
  5. Cheese Distribution: Spread cheese evenly to ensure every bite is perfectly cheesy, and consider using freshly grated mozzarella for the best melting properties.
  6. Resting the Dough: Don't skip the 10-minute resting period - this allows gluten to relax, making the dough easier to stretch and resulting in a more tender crust.
